This file exposes an object that contains public classes `Linter`, `ESLint`, `RuleTester`, and `SourceCode`. * `lib/cli.js` - this is the heart of the ESLint CLI. It takes an array of arguments and then uses `eslint` to execute the commands. By keeping this as a separate utility, it allows others to effectively call ESLint from within another Node.js program as if it were done on the command line. The main call is `cli.execute()`. This is also the part that does all the file reading, directory traversing, input, and output. * `lib/init/` - this module contains `--init` functionality that set up a configuration file for end users. * `lib/cli-engine/` - this module is `CLIEngine` class that finds source code files and configuration files then does code verifying with the `Linter` class. This includes the loading logic of configuration files, parsers, plugins, and formatters.
